Key Responsibilities:
  • Employee Relations (ER):  Provide expert guidance and support to team leads and managers, navigating employee relations matters to ensure a compliant and positive workplace culture.
  • Coaching & Performance Management:  Work closely with leaders to coach them through performance management processes, provide constructive feedback, and support the implementation of learning models to enhance leadership capability.
  • Recruitment & Onboarding:  Oversee recruitment at all levels.
  • HR Administration & Reporting:  Assist with general HR administration, ensuring efficient processes and systems are in place. Own  WGEA reporting  and handle HR operational data reporting.
  • Systems & Reporting:  Support the implementation of a new  HRIS/ERP system , assist with team training, and contribute to data reporting for HR functions to improve operational efficiency.
  • Strategic HR Planning:  Collaborate with senior leadership to align HR initiatives with business goals and long-term strategy.
  • Organisational Development:  Support employee engagement and retention programs, contributing to the  growth and scalability  of the business.
  • Diversity and Inclusion:  Lead or support initiatives to promote diversity, inclusion, and employee wellbeing.
  • Change Management:  Lead and support organisational change processes, ensuring smooth transitions and employee alignment with evolving business goals.
